What is a Shipping Container?
A shipping container is a robust modular unit, created primarily for carrying products throughout various modes of transport, from ships to trucks. However, their toughness and budget friendly rates have made them a popular choice for various alternative usages, such as storage, workshops, and even mobile homes.

The process of renting a shipping container is simple. Here are actions to direct you through:
Determine Your Needs: Assess what you'll be using the shipping container for (storage, office, and so on) and identify the size based upon your requirements.Research Rental Companies: Look for trustworthy rental services in your location. Checking out evaluations and seeking recommendations can assist discover dependable suppliers.Request Quotes: Contact numerous rental companies for rates options. Make sure to clarify the terms, conditions, and delivery/pickup fees if appropriate.Evaluation the Lease Agreement: Scrutinize the contract for rental duration, costs, maintenance obligations, and penalties for late returns.Select Delivery Options: Decide on whether you'll choose up the container or need it delivered to your location.Check the Container: Before accepting the container, inspect its condition and ensure it satisfies your requirements.Table 2: Average Costs of Renting Shipping Containers (monthly)Container SizeAverage Monthly Rental RateDelivery Charge (if relevant)10'₤ 100 - ₤ 200₤ 100 - ₤ 30020'₤ 200 - ₤ 300₤ 100 - ₤ 30040'₤ 300 - ₤ 500₤ 100 - ₤ 500Aspects Affecting Container Rental Pricing
Comprehending what affects rental rates can assist people and companies find the very best deal. Here are essential aspects:
Container Condition: Newer containers or those in exceptional condition might cost more than older, used ones.Area: Rental prices differ by region due to regional demand, transport expenses, and availability.Rental Duration: Longer rental terms frequently feature lowered regular monthly rates.Personalization and Modifications: If occupants require modifications (e.g., doors, windows, insulation), this might raise the rent.Tips for a Smooth Shipping Container Rental ExperiencePlan Ahead: Ensure all rental arrangements remain in place before you require the container to avoid last-minute tension.File the Condition: Take videos/photos of the container before and after usage for reference relating to damage/conditions.Know Local Regulations: Some municipalities have specific guidelines relating to storage containers on-site. Check local laws to ensure compliance.Prepare the Site: If the container is to be put on a website, prepare the ground with the essential area and a strong foundation.Consider Insurance: Consult with your insurance supplier concerning coverage for the leased container and its contents.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
